Popularity of Urban Design at CSUN

In 2021, 15 students received their master’s degree in urban design from CSUN. This makes it the #31 most popular school for urban design master’s degree candidates in the country.

CSUN Urban & Regional Planning, General Master’s Program

Of the 15 urban design students who graduated with a master's degree in 2020-2021 from CSUN, about 40% were men and 60% were women.

The majority of the master's degree graduates for this major are Hispanic or Latino.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 60% of grads f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from California State University - Northridge with a master's in urban design.

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 1
Hispanic or Latino 9
White 2
Non-Resident Aliens 2
Other Races 1
